UNDERSTANDING WHAT REALLY HAPPENS WHEN SKIN AGES
Aging is far more complex than simple wrinkles and sagging. At the cellular level, your skin undergoes profound structural changes over time that dictate its outward appearance:
- Collagen Depletion: This protein provides structure and firmness; however, production begins to drop as early as our mid-20s.
- Elastin Weakening: The fibers responsible for the skin's "bounce" lose their resilience, leading to laxity.
- Slower Turnover: Skin cell regeneration decelerates, meaning dead cells linger longer on the surface, creating a dull, rough texture.
- Oxidative Stress: Environmental factors like UV exposure and pollution create free radicals—unstable molecules that scavenge and damage healthy cellular DNA.
Researchers now recognize that aging is a mosaic of genetic and environmental factors. While we cannot stop time, we can scientifically manipulate the factors that accelerate the clock.
BREAKTHROUGH INGREDIENTS: FROM LABORATORIES TO VANITY TABLES
The next generation of skincare hinges on high-tech ingredients capable of acting at a molecular level. These aren't just surface-level moisturizers; they are messengers that talk to your cells.
Retinoids and Vitamin A: Modern science has mastered encapsulated retinoids. Unlike older, harsher formulas, these provide a slow-release mechanism that stimulates collagen and speeds up cell turnover while minimizing irritation.
The Power of Peptides: Peptides are short chains of amino acids that act as "building blocks." When applied topically, they signal the skin to repair itself, effectively tricking the body into producing more collagen and improving overall elasticity.
Advanced Antioxidant Delivery: Antioxidants like Vitamin C, Vitamin E, and Niacinamide are the skin's primary defense against oxidative stress. Breakthroughs in nanotechnology now allow these molecules to penetrate much deeper into the dermis, ensuring they work where the damage actually occurs.
THE SCIENCE OF CELLULAR REGENERATION
Perhaps the most buzzworthy field in anti-aging is cellular rejuvenation. Scientists are moving beyond hydration to look at growth factors and senolytics:
- Growth Factors: These are proteins naturally found in young skin that trigger healing. Topical formulations containing these proteins can prompt your own stem cells to act more youthfully.
- Senolytics: This cutting-edge field targets "zombie cells"—aged cells that refuse to die and instead cause inflammation in surrounding tissue. By clearing these away, we may unlock the ability to truly refresh the skin's foundation.
PERSONALIZED SKINCARE: HARNESSING AI AND GENETIC TESTING
No two people age exactly the same way, and science is finally embracing this reality through hyper-personalization.
- AI Analysis: Artificial intelligence now analyzes high-resolution skin scans to track microscopic changes over time, recommending routines based on specific environmental exposures.
- DNA Profiling: Some companies offer at-home genetic tests to reveal your biological predisposition to collagen breakdown or pigmentation.
- Custom Formulations: This data allows for the creation of bespoke serums tailored to your unique skin profile, regardless of ethnicity or hormonal background.
LIFESTYLE MEETS BIOTECH: BEYOND CREAMS AND SERUMS
The modern approach recognizes that topical treatments are only one pillar of a holistic strategy. Cutting-edge research affirms that internal health is inseparable from external radiance.
- Nutritional Support: Omega-3 fatty acids and oral collagen supplements are now scientifically linked to improved skin barrier function.
- Light Therapy: LED and Red Light devices have surged in popularity for their proven ability to reduce inflammation and stimulate mitochondrial activity in skin cells.
- Minimally Invasive Tech: Procedures like microneedling and advanced lasers are evolving to be safer and more effective at resurfacing texture with minimal downtime.
